Output cfd577ba650358b829af254aa95f16632828e2dd7dc45f60f5c0ef5a743966e7:0

value
699850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42666a5219787d66bb7ce93cdc4a088c7200530f OP_EQUAL
address
37k7D9PRtn87kZUuYACTvhxdqSwKiT9bUC
transaction
cfd577ba650358b829af254aa95f16632828e2dd7dc45f60f5c0ef5a743966e7
confirmations
451840
spent
true